在Spring Boot 项目中创建一个 Pulsar 消息生产者: importorg.apache.pulsar.client.api.*;@ServicepublicclassPulsarProducer{privatefinalProducer<String>producer;publicPulsarProducer(PulsarClientpulsarClient)throwsPulsarClientException{// 创建一个 Pulsar 生产者this.producer=pulsarClient.newProducer(Schema.STRING).t...
测试Spring Boot与Pulsar的集成是否成功: 启动Spring Boot应用,并通过发送HTTP请求或查看日志来验证Pulsar的生产者和消费者是否正常工作。例如,可以发送一个GET请求到/send端点来发送消息,并观察消费者是否成功接收到消息。 通过以上步骤,你可以成功地将Spring Boot应用与Apache Pulsar集成,实现基本的消息发送和接收功能。
使用SpringBoot 整合 Pulsar 客户端,首先引入 Pulsar 客户端依赖,代码如下: 代码语言:javascript 代码运行次数:0 复制 Cloud Studio代码运行 <dependency><groupId>org.apache.pulsar</groupId><artifactId>pulsar-client</artifactId><version>2.9.1</version></dependency> 然后在 properties 文件中添加配置: 代码语...
pulsar: 批量接收消息 【代码】pulsar: 批量接收消息。 pulsar apache System kafka Pulsar 消息概念1 Pulsar官方文档概念和架构-MessagingConcepts中主要内容1消息组成|组成|说明||---|---||Value/datapayload|消息携带的数据,所有pulsar的消息携带原始bytes,但是消息数据也需要遵循数据shcema||Key|消息可以被Key打标...
使用SpringBoot 整合 Pulsar 客户端,首先引入 Pulsar 客户端依赖,代码如下: org.apache.pulsarpulsar-client2.9.1 然后在 properties 文件中添加配置: # Pulsar 地址 pulsar.url=pulsar://192.168.59.155:6650 # topic pulsar.topic=testTopic # consumer group ...
使用Pulsar Admin CLI工具创建一个新的主题,例如financial-transactions。 设置独占订阅模式,确保每个交易请求都由单一消费者处理。 集成SpringBoot应用: 在SpringBoot项目中添加Pulsar客户端依赖,如pulsar-client库。 配置Pulsar连接信息,包括Broker地址、认证方式等。
启动sringboot项目,会自动连接pulsar,成功后会并且打印配置信息,如果失败则项目会自动停止。 此时我们也可以通过管理后台查看注册的主题和当前的消费者信息; 在Swagger中调用接口进行测试; 调用成功后,控制台将输入如下信息,表示消息已经被成功接收并消费了。
importio.github.majusko.pulsar.producer.ProducerFactory; importorg.springframework.context.annotation.Bean; importorg.springframework.context.annotation.Configuration; /** * 生产者相关配置 * 1.topic要提前在控制台中完成创建 * 2.消息类型需要实现Serializable接口 ...
目前Pulsar 支持多种语言的客户端,包括: Java 客户端Go 客户端Python 客户端C++ 客户端Node.js 客户端WebSocket 客户端C# 客户端 SpringBoot 配置 使用SpringBoot 整合 Pulsar 客户端,首先引入 Pulsar 客户端依赖,代码如下: <dependency> <groupId>org.apache.pulsar</groupId> ...
spring boot整合pulsar springboot整合disruptor 在第一篇中()我们已经搭建了基础的springboot项目讲述了搭建基本的springboot项目+mybatis+mysql数据库,详细的增删改查就不再写了,不知道的可以去百度或者提问。本文章开始讲述自定义拦截器的类容。 1.首先创建拦截器 AuthInterceptor 继承字 HandlerInterceptorAdapter 并重写...